Social Security offices across the State of Illinois will be closed to the public for in-person service starting today.

The move was made due to the average population the office serves, older Americans with underlying medical conditions, who are most susceptible to COVID-19.  The Social Security Offices will remain providing critical servies to the public both by phone and online.

You can visit the website here to get started applying for retirement, disability and Medicare benefits, or call 1-800-772-1213 (TTY 1-800-325-0778)
